Time Difference

is 4 hours and 30 minutes behind AEST (Australian Eastern Standard Time)
2:00 am02:00 in Eravur Town, Sri Lanka is 6:30 am06:30 in Dandenong North, Australia

Eravur Town to Dandenong North call time
Best time for a conference call or a meeting is between 8am-1:30pm in Eravur Town which corresponds to 12:30pm-6pm in Dandenong North

Daylight Saving Time Starts
Daylight saving time clock moves forward for one hour from 2am to 3am Sunday, October 6, 2024 at 2:00 am local time. DST starts annually the on first Sunday of October. Clocks are turned forward 1 hour to Sunday, October 6, 2024, 3:00 am local daylight time instead. Also called Spring Forward or Summer Time.
Daylight Saving Time Ends
Daylight saving time clock moves back for one hour from 3am to 2am Sunday, April 7, 2024 at 3:00 am local time. DST ends annually the on first Sunday of April. Clocks are turned backward 1 hour to Sunday, April 7, 2024, 2:00 am local standard time instead. Also called Fall Back or switch to Winter Time.
